Key Roles In A Brisbane SEO Team
Each role centers on a distinct facet of the diffusion model while contributing to measurable local outcomes. The titles below reflect common industry practice in Brisbane and align with governance requirements that make audits straightforward and reproducible across surfaces.
- SEO Specialist: Owns local keyword research, short- and mid-term optimization, and performance tracking. Works closely with Content Strategist to ensure Brisbane-specific intents guide on-page changes, while maintaining provenance notes that satisfy regulatory and audit needs.
- Content Strategist: Plans and governs the local content calendar, ensuring spine_topic alignment across Local Pages, suburb-focused landing pages, and feature content for Discover experiences. Collaborates with SEO, Design, and Local Teams to translate Brisbane signals into engaging, conversion-ready narratives.
- Technical SEO Analyst: Maintains site health, speed, structured data, and crawlability. Prioritizes Core Web Vitals and mobile usability to support diffusion across eight surfaces, ensuring technical changes preserve spine_topic semantics and are fully auditable.
- Data‑Driven SEO Analyst: Builds dashboards that track local visibility, traffic quality, and near-term conversions. Analyzes attribution across the diffusion surfaces to inform strategy, deliverables, and governance reports.
- Local SEO Specialist: Manages GBP health, NAP consistency, and suburb-level Local Pages with accurate hours, events, and service areas. Coordinates local citations and community signals to improve proximity-based rankings in Brisbane neighborhoods.
- SEO Manager / Lead: Oversees strategy, governance, and cross‑functional alignment. Balances client or internal stakeholder priorities with eight-surface diffusion requirements and regulator-ready provenance, ensuring scalable growth across Brisbane regions.
- SEO Copywriter / Content Publisher: Produces locale-aware copy that respects Brisbane terminology and user intent. Ensures messaging remains consistent with spine_topic while adapting tone to neighborhood contexts and platform constraints.
- Outreach / Local PR Specialist (optional but common in Brisbane): Builds local signals through citations, media mentions, and community partnerships. Aligns outreach with the diffusion framework, preserving licensing disclosures and provenance for audits.

Core Hard Skills For Brisbane SEO Professionals
- Local keyword research with Brisbane-specific intents, suburb variations, and event-driven queries.
- On-page optimization using Brisbane terminology in titles, meta descriptions, headings, and internal linking structures.
- Technical SEO and site health management focused on fast loading, mobile usability, structured data, and crawlability to support diffusion across eight surfaces.
- Information architecture and governance of spine_topic to ensure surface wrappers travel without semantic drift.
- Analytics, dashboards, and measurement practices that translate local signals into actionable insights.
- Local SEO execution including GBP health, NAP consistency, and suburb-level Local Pages with accurate hours and events.
- Content strategy and governance that align with spine_topic while enabling surface-specific storytelling for Maps, Local Pages, and Discover experiences.
- Structured data and schema governance for local entities, venues, and services to strengthen EEAT credibility across surfaces.

Essential Tools And Platforms For Brisbane SEO Roles
- Analytics and data governance: GA4 for cross-surface journey data, GSC for crawl and performance insights, and a unified visualization layer tied to a spine_topic-driven data model.
- Keyword research and competitive intelligence: Ahrefs, Semrush, Moz to map Brisbane intent to local surface opportunities and prioritize surface wrappers that serve Maps, Local Pages, and Discover experiences.
- Crawling and site auditing: Screaming Frog, Sitebulb, and OnCrawl for in-depth site health checks across surface-specific renderings while preserving provenance.
- Local SEO tooling: BrightLocal and Whitespark to monitor GBP health, citations, and suburb-level presence in Brisbane markets.
- Local business management: GBP management tooling to maintain listings, reviews, and event signals feeding Maps and Local Packs.
- Content management and collaboration: CMS familiarity (WordPress, Drupal, or enterprise CMS) plus collaboration tools to coordinate across eight surfaces.
- Tagging and experimentation: Google Tag Manager for surface-aware event tagging and controlled experiments that preserve spine_topic semantics.
